The episode recounted in Exodus 17 features the Israelites quarreling with Moses about the lack of water, and Moses rebuking the Israelites for testing Yahweh; verse 7 states that it was on this account that the place gained the name Massah, meaning testing, and the name Meribah meaning quarreling.

Is Massah and meribah the same?

Massah (Hebrew: מַסָּה‎) and Meribah (Hebrew: מְרִיבָה‎, also spelled “Mirabah”) are place names found in the Hebrew Bible. The Israelites are said to have travelled through Massah and Meribah during the Exodus, although the continuous list of visited stations in Numbers 33 does not mention this.

What is the meaning of Kadesh?

Kadesh or Qadesh or Cades (in classical Hebrew Hebrew: קָדֵשׁ, from the root קדש‎ “holy”) is a place-name that occurs several times in the Hebrew Bible, describing a site or sites located south of, or at the southern border of, Canaan and the Kingdom of Judah in the kingdom of Israel.

What is the significance of Kadesh in the Bible?

Kadesh was the chief site of encampment for the Israelites during their wandering in the Zin Desert (Deuteronomy 1:46), as well as the place from which the Israelite spies were sent to Canaan (Numbers 13:1-26). The first failed attempt to capture Canaan was made from Kadesh (Numbers 14:40-45).

What is the meaning of Dreams in the Bible?

Dreams can warn a person not to do something (Genesis 20:3, 31:24, Matthew 27:19). They can convey what will happen either in the near or distant future (Genesis 37:5, 9, 40:8 – 19, 41:1 – 7, 15 – 32, Daniel 2, 7). Dreams can convey a spiritual truth (Genesis 28:12).

What is a message Dream?

Message dreams typically do not require interpretation, and they often involve direct instructions that are delivered by a deity or a divine assistant. Before the birth of Jesus Christ, Joseph had three message dreams concerning upcoming events (Matthew 1:20-25; 2:13, 19-20).

What does the Bible say about the Wise Men’s dreams?

In Matthew 2:12, the wise men were warned in a message dream not to return to Herod. And in Acts 16:9, the Apostle Paul experienced a night vision of a man urging him to go to Macedonia. This vision in the night was likely a message dream.
